The 25-year-old clinical finisher has affirmed his aspiration to switch nationality allegiance and play for the Gulf Region nation on the international stage following successful seasons in the Bahrain top-flight so far
Bahrain-based Ghanaian wing-forward Daniel Asante has revealed his readiness to play for the Bahrain national football team if he is being approached by the Bahrain FA.

The former New Edubiase attacking forward, who can operate across the flanks on the field of play, has stated that playing for the Red at the international level remains a dream for him after spending most of his footballing career in the Bahrain football competitions.

Speaking in an exclusive interview with Kickgh from his base in Bahrain, the Budaiya Club versatile wing-forward has said of his aspiration to don the colours of the Asian country at the senior national level.

He told Kickgh.com: ''When it comes to playing on the international stage, l am ever ready to play for the Bahrain national football team. l have been playing in their league for almost six seasons now and l believe that l am now more accustomed to their climatic conditions. So to switch nationality allegiance and represent them on the international front would not be an issue at all for me.''

Asante said the national team coach has been watching the games of the various clubs in the Bahrain Premier League and he hopes to catch the eyes of the gaffer with his great performance in order to realize his dream of playing for them in the near future.
''l am very much aware that the national team coach has been monitoring players in the league. And as that continues to happen, l know for sure that l would be able to attract his attention with my performances in league games going forward. So considering all these factors, l have the belief that l would one day get the opportunity to play for their national football team.''

Despite his injury plights this term, Asante has so far played in 13 games by scoring 6 goals and setting up another 3 for Budaiya Club in this ongoing Bahraini Premier League.
Having recovered from a Grade 1 hamstring strain injury, he could be in contention to feature for his side when they face Al-Hidd SCC in their next league fixtures on Friday (April 3).
